From: Eric Dumazet <edumazet@google.com>
[ Upstream commit be69483bf4f3abaaca5d5ba460dbb50239463552 ]
Use BPF_REG_1 for source and destination of gso_segs read,
to exercise "bpf: fix access to skb_shared_info->gso_segs" fix.
Signed-off-by: Eric Dumazet <edumazet@google.com>
Suggested-by: Stanislav Fomichev <sdf@google.com>
Signed-off-by: Alexei Starovoitov <ast@kernel.org>
Signed-off-by: Sasha Levin <sashal@kernel.org>
---
t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/ctx_skb.c | 11 +++++++++++
1 file changed, 11 insertions(+)
di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/ctx_skb.c b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/ctx_skb.c
index b0fda2877119c..d438193804b21 100644
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/ctx_skb.c
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/verifier/ctx_skb.c
@@ -974,6 +974,17 @@
.result = ACCEPT,
.prog_type = BPF_PROG_TYPE_CGROUP_SKB,
},
+{
+ "read gso_segs from CGROUP_SKB",
+ .insns = {
+ BPF_LDX_MEM(BPF_W, BPF_REG_1, BPF_REG_1,
+ offsetof(struct __sk_buff, gso_segs)),
+ BPF_MOV64_IMM(BPF_REG_0, 0),
+ BPF_EXIT_INSN(),
+ },
+ .result = ACCEPT,
+ .prog_type = BPF_PROG_TYPE_CGROUP_SKB,
+},
{
"write gso_segs from CGROUP_SKB",
.insns = {
